Facilities Ticket — Cleaning Crew Access, Brindle Annex

For new starters handling evening lock-up: the Sorano Cleaning crew arrives nightly at 21:30 via the annex side door. Check their rota sheet, note arrival in the log, and ensure the storeroom is relocked afterward. To let them through the side door, enter the access code below.

badge for yaweg-hafog: bdg-GX-6

## Data Stores: Build Agent Clock Skew

Build timestamps on the Calder fleet can drift up to 90 seconds between agents. Never compare artifact times across agents; use the sequence column instead. NTP sync runs hourly. Skew readings are logged to the metrics store — to query them, use the connection string below.

primary connection of yagep-kahip = redis://giliel_svc:zYiKsLL2PLpfPL@db-348f.xolmarsys.corp:5432/fenwyn

Runbook: GarageGlance occupancy feed

If the Harborview Deck occupancy feed goes stale (no updates for 5+ minutes), first check the sensor gateway health page. Green but stale usually means the aggregator queue is backed up; restart the aggregator via the ops console and counts should recover within two minutes. If spots show negative numbers, force a full recount from the camera snapshots. When escalating to engineering, include the trace token shown below.

session token of yawif-kahof = htk9_dd6996ed6

Off-site run — item 7: Returned demo units from the Ostrell showroom. Two boxes, taped and labeled, staged near the loading door. Contents already inventoried, so no need to recount. Deliver to the refurb bench at the Davenmere annex; anyone on shift can sign the internal slip. For the actual hand-over at the dock, apply the confidential instruction printed below:

handover note for yagef-bagep: the drudor pelius courier leaves the kasdor zorvan norir ledger at gate 8016 under passcode 755406